This data graph runs on a single endpoint and allows you to query all fields from all of your APIs and integrations, which can save you development time and provide a better developer experience.Īnypoint DataGraph uses the GraphQL query language, which allows you to send a query to your DataGraph endpoint and get exactly what information you need, nothing more and nothing less. To solve this problem, Anypoint DataGraph allows you to connect all of your REST APIs together with metadata that graphs each API schema together. You will need to create custom code in order to parse the data from each response, and with each request you get all fields-not just the ones you need. As you create a new REST API, it starts to become significant work to parse the data you need for each project as your API library grows. The average enterprise connects with over 900+ systems, so as a developer, you may be forced to create hundreds of APIs for your organization.
